#413ACF Hex color

#413ACF

The hexadecimal color code #413ACF corresponds to the code RGB( 65, 58, 207 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,25 level), green (at 0,23 level) and blue (at 0,81 level). Its brightness is 51% and its saturation is 60%. It is composed of red at 19%, green at 17% and blue at 62%. The dominant component is blue.
